Scan barcode
160 pages • missing pub info (editions)
ISBN/UID: 9781846376801
Format: Paperback
Language: English
Publisher: Echo Library
Publication date: 31 October 2005
160 pages • missing pub info (editions)
ISBN/UID: 9781846376801
Format: Paperback
Language: English
Publisher: Echo Library
Publication date: 31 October 2005
220 pages • first pub 1853 (editions)
ISBN/UID: 9781406548075
Format: Paperback
Language: English
Publisher: Dodo Pr
Publication date: Not specified
220 pages • first pub 1853 (editions)
ISBN/UID: 9781406548075
Format: Paperback
Language: English
Publisher: Dodo Pr
Publication date: Not specified
222 pages • missing pub info (editions)
ISBN/UID: 9783734096266
Format: Paperback
Language: English
Publisher: Outlook Verlag
Publication date: 25 September 2019
222 pages • missing pub info (editions)
ISBN/UID: 9783734096266
Format: Paperback
Language: English
Publisher: Outlook Verlag
Publication date: 25 September 2019
222 pages • missing pub info (editions)
ISBN/UID: 9783734096273
Format: Hardcover
Language: English
Publisher: Outlook Verlag
Publication date: 25 September 2019
222 pages • missing pub info (editions)
ISBN/UID: 9783734096273
Format: Hardcover
Language: English
Publisher: Outlook Verlag
Publication date: 25 September 2019